Job description

Responsible for providing expert technical advice, consulting to customers and sales team and architecting Canon Solutions America solutions based in the customer needs. Exhibits an equal measure of consulting on the process improvements and technical skills and/or experience. Demonstrates technical and investigating abilities to establish themselves as a value-added resource, and trusted advisor/consultant to our internal direct Sales organization.- Extensive travel is required, up to 70% with overnight stays in the Ohio Valley Area (valid drivers' license and acceptable driving record necessary). 
- Works with assigned internal Sales teams to strategize/develop/participate in solutions revenue initiatives.
- Partners with each Sales Manager within the respective assignment to develop an active plan for achieving Software Solutions and Professional Services revenue targets.
- As a technical advisor, interfaces with customers, sponsors, and all other stakeholders to identify improvement opportunities in their current business processes.
- Generates the highest level of system requirements, based on the customer's needs and other constraints such as budget and schedule. Ensuring requirements are consistent, complete, accurate and operationally defined.
- Develop a Proof of Concept (POC) to be delivered to the customer for their review and approval, when necessary.
- Develops a Statement of Work (SOW) that will outline the customer requirements responsibilities, and Canon Solutions America deliverables.
- Analysts are measured on 1) solutions & professional services revenue generated by the Sales teams they support, 2) technical knowledge of our products and their use cases through professional development objectives and 3) administrative skills such as project management, project documentation, forecasting accuracy, and time management. 
-Bachelor's degree in a relevant field or equivalent experience required, plus 3+ years successfully supporting software sales with an internal Sales team is required.
-Direct Sales experience 
- Thorough understanding of Information Technology systems and terminology.
- Excellent verbal and written communications, with the ability to adapt one's communication style to three levels of internal/external clients (External Customers, Internal Sales Leadership, Internal Sales Reps).
- Demonstrable personal organizational skills and attention to detail.
--Desirable industry certifications include G7 Expert, Fiery Expert and Fiery Professional. IT fundamentals and/or Network certifications a plus.
--Understanding of complex systems solutions, integration and networking in Windows and Macintosh environments.
--A working knowledge of production applications such Web2Print, Makeready, Output management, Variable Data, Mailing Solutions and Color Management experience.
--Certified Color Management Professional and experience in black and white printing with data stream and data conversion software experience.
--Additional Data Stream knowledge – AFP, VIPP, PPML and LCDS/Metacode a plus.
--Understand and be comfortable using the Adobe Creative Suite product, and/or other standard color composition and management tools and respective file formats (JPEG, TIFF, EPS, and PDF). Able to use and operate Postscript/PDF file handling tools, such as Acrobat Pro Distiller, etc.
